Rakan Khalifa is an entrepreneur who started from scratch and made a name for himself in the digital world. Born in Saudi Arabia, he moved to Canada in 2013 and ventured into various opportunities. Rakan founded Game Changers Worldwide, a successful organization focused on helping people improve their financial statuses through digital platforms. His leadership and expertise have earned him the title of "Millionaire Mentor." Rakan aims to inspire millions of individuals to take action and achieve success. His vision includes expanding his company globally and empowering over a million users with trading and investing skills.
